Branding
I love branding. I enjoy finally being able to be outside and not be freezing(most of the time). To me branding means that spring is finally in full swing because the cows will leave to go out on the grass not too long after. When we brand we use Nord Forks. They are an amazing invention that makes branding so much easier. The cowboy ropes the calf by his heels and then the calf is dragged to these forks. These forks are attatched to a rope which is attached to a deflated inner tube which is attatched to a bungie rope and that rope is attatched to a stake in the ground whoo! As the calf is dragged by these forks by the cowboy, the headcatcher sets the fork over the calfs neck and then the cowboy and his horse pull the rope just tight enough so that the calf can't move and then he is branded and given his shots(that's what I do) and then they pull the off the fork and the cowboy slacks his rope and the calf runs over with the other calves that have been branded. One calf can be done in about 20 seconds, our family has it down to a real art:) And then we gather all of the cows and calves up and take them out to the green grass. Yay!
